Personal info

Full name
LODWICK, Lloyd Perry
Date of birth
25 August 1913
Age
31
Place of birth
West Point, Lee County, Iowa
Hometown
Burlington, Des Moines County, Iowa

Military service

Service number
37681918
Rank
Private First Class
Function
unknown
Unit
D Company,
1st Battalion,
142nd Infantry Regiment,
36th Infantry Division
Awards
Purple Heart

Death

Status
Died of Wounds
Date of death
8 January 1945
Place of death
In the vicinity of Lemberg, France

Grave

Cemetery
American War Cemetery Epinal
Plot Row Grave
B 33 25

Immediate family

Members
Fred S. Lodwick (father)
Eva V. (Doty) Lodwick (mother)
Edward C. Lodwick (brother)
Mildred V. Lodwick (sister)
Lester H. Lodwick (half-brother)
Fern S. Lodwick (sister)
John Lodwick (brother)
Dorothy E. (Harker) Lodwick (wife)
Jerry L. Lodwick (son)

More information

Pfc Lloyd P. Lodwick was married to Dorothy Elizabeth Harker on 29 July 1939.

He enlisted on 18 November 1943 at Camp Dodge, Iowa.
